Skip to content

Simplify and unify gtest build (#630) #4017

Simplify and unify gtest build (#630)

Simplify and unify gtest build (#630) #4017

Status Success
Total duration 56m 58s
Artifacts 17

main.yml

on: push
pre-commit  /  pre-commit
1m 23s
pre-commit / pre-commit
Matrix: ubuntu / clang-build
Matrix: mac / clang-build
Matrix: ubuntu / gcc-build
Matrix: windows / msvc-build
Matrix: ubuntu / clang-sanitizer-build
Matrix: ubuntu / clang-test
Matrix: ubuntu / gcc-test
Matrix: ubuntu / clang-sanitizer-test
Matrix: ubuntu / clang-test-extended
mac  /  clang-test-extended
3m 24s
mac / clang-test-extended
Matrix: ubuntu / gcc-test-extended
windows  /  msvc-test-extended
3m 9s
windows / msvc-test-extended
windows  /  clang-test-extended
2m 48s
windows / clang-test-extended
Matrix: ubuntu / clang-sanitizer-test-extended
ubuntu  /  gcc-build-codecov
5m 59s
ubuntu / gcc-build-codecov
perf  /  ubuntu-gcc-build-perf-stats
1m 33s
perf / ubuntu-gcc-build-perf-stats
perf  /  macos-clang-build-perf-stats
1m 59s
perf / macos-clang-build-perf-stats
pages  /  build-doxygen-xml
1m 48s
pages / build-doxygen-xml
pages  /  build-scoreboard
16s
pages / build-scoreboard
pages  /  deploy-pages
0s
pages / deploy-pages
Fit to window
Zoom out
Zoom in

Annotations

1 error, 26 warnings, and 7 notices
ubuntu / gcc-build-codecov
Missing either 'issue-number' or 'comment-id'.
ubuntu / gcc-build (ubuntu-24.04, Release)
No files were found with the provided path: build/revert-list.txt. No artifacts will be uploaded.
mac / clang-build (Release)
openssl@3 3.5.2 is already installed and up-to-date. To reinstall 3.5.2, run: brew reinstall openssl@3
mac / clang-build (Release)
ninja 1.13.1 is already installed and up-to-date. To reinstall 1.13.1, run: brew reinstall ninja
windows / msvc-build (Debug)
Unable to locate executable file: C:\ProgramData\Chocolatey\bin\ccache.exe C:\Strawberry\c\bin\ccache.exe. Please verify either the file path exists or the file can be found within a directory specified by the PATH environment variable. Also verify the file has a valid extension for an executable file.
windows / msvc-build (Debug)
Unable to locate executable file: C:\ProgramData\Chocolatey\bin\ccache.exe C:\Strawberry\c\bin\ccache.exe. Please verify either the file path exists or the file can be found within a directory specified by the PATH environment variable. Also verify the file has a valid extension for an executable file.
windows / msvc-build (Release)
Unable to locate executable file: C:\ProgramData\Chocolatey\bin\ccache.exe C:\Strawberry\c\bin\ccache.exe. Please verify either the file path exists or the file can be found within a directory specified by the PATH environment variable. Also verify the file has a valid extension for an executable file.
windows / msvc-build (Release)
Unable to locate executable file: C:\ProgramData\Chocolatey\bin\ccache.exe C:\Strawberry\c\bin\ccache.exe. Please verify either the file path exists or the file can be found within a directory specified by the PATH environment variable. Also verify the file has a valid extension for an executable file.
windows / clang-build
Unable to locate executable file: C:\ProgramData\Chocolatey\bin\ccache.exe C:\Strawberry\c\bin\ccache.exe. Please verify either the file path exists or the file can be found within a directory specified by the PATH environment variable. Also verify the file has a valid extension for an executable file.
windows / clang-build
Unable to locate executable file: C:\ProgramData\Chocolatey\bin\ccache.exe C:\Strawberry\c\bin\ccache.exe. Please verify either the file path exists or the file can be found within a directory specified by the PATH environment variable. Also verify the file has a valid extension for an executable file.
mac / clang-build (Debug)
openssl@3 3.5.2 is already installed and up-to-date. To reinstall 3.5.2, run: brew reinstall openssl@3
mac / clang-build (Debug)
ninja 1.13.1 is already installed and up-to-date. To reinstall 1.13.1, run: brew reinstall ninja
windows / clang-test
Unable to locate executable file: C:\ProgramData\Chocolatey\bin\ccache.exe C:\Strawberry\c\bin\ccache.exe. Please verify either the file path exists or the file can be found within a directory specified by the PATH environment variable. Also verify the file has a valid extension for an executable file.
windows / clang-test
Unable to locate executable file: C:\ProgramData\Chocolatey\bin\ccache.exe C:\Strawberry\c\bin\ccache.exe. Please verify either the file path exists or the file can be found within a directory specified by the PATH environment variable. Also verify the file has a valid extension for an executable file.
windows / msvc-test
Unable to locate executable file: C:\ProgramData\Chocolatey\bin\ccache.exe C:\Strawberry\c\bin\ccache.exe. Please verify either the file path exists or the file can be found within a directory specified by the PATH environment variable. Also verify the file has a valid extension for an executable file.
windows / msvc-test
Unable to locate executable file: C:\ProgramData\Chocolatey\bin\ccache.exe C:\Strawberry\c\bin\ccache.exe. Please verify either the file path exists or the file can be found within a directory specified by the PATH environment variable. Also verify the file has a valid extension for an executable file.
windows / clang-test-extended
Unable to locate executable file: C:\ProgramData\Chocolatey\bin\ccache.exe C:\Strawberry\c\bin\ccache.exe. Please verify either the file path exists or the file can be found within a directory specified by the PATH environment variable. Also verify the file has a valid extension for an executable file.
windows / clang-test-extended
Unable to locate executable file: C:\ProgramData\Chocolatey\bin\ccache.exe C:\Strawberry\c\bin\ccache.exe. Please verify either the file path exists or the file can be found within a directory specified by the PATH environment variable. Also verify the file has a valid extension for an executable file.
mac / clang-test
openssl@3 3.5.2 is already installed and up-to-date. To reinstall 3.5.2, run: brew reinstall openssl@3
mac / clang-test
ninja 1.13.1 is already installed and up-to-date. To reinstall 1.13.1, run: brew reinstall ninja
windows / msvc-test-extended
Unable to locate executable file: C:\ProgramData\Chocolatey\bin\ccache.exe C:\Strawberry\c\bin\ccache.exe. Please verify either the file path exists or the file can be found within a directory specified by the PATH environment variable. Also verify the file has a valid extension for an executable file.
windows / msvc-test-extended
Unable to locate executable file: C:\ProgramData\Chocolatey\bin\ccache.exe C:\Strawberry\c\bin\ccache.exe. Please verify either the file path exists or the file can be found within a directory specified by the PATH environment variable. Also verify the file has a valid extension for an executable file.
mac / clang-test-extended
openssl@3 3.5.2 is already installed and up-to-date. To reinstall 3.5.2, run: brew reinstall openssl@3
mac / clang-test-extended
ninja 1.13.1 is already installed and up-to-date. To reinstall 1.13.1, run: brew reinstall ninja
perf / macos-clang-build-perf-stats
No files were found with the provided path: perf-stat-macos.zip. No artifacts will be uploaded.
perf / macos-clang-build-perf-stats
openssl@3 3.5.2 is already installed and up-to-date. To reinstall 3.5.2, run: brew reinstall openssl@3
perf / macos-clang-build-perf-stats
ninja 1.13.1 is already installed and up-to-date. To reinstall 1.13.1, run: brew reinstall ninja
windows / msvc-build (Debug)
The windows-latest label will migrate from Windows Server 2022 to Windows Server 2025 beginning September 2, 2025. For more information see https://github.com/actions/runner-images/issues/12677
windows / msvc-build (Release)
The windows-latest label will migrate from Windows Server 2022 to Windows Server 2025 beginning September 2, 2025. For more information see https://github.com/actions/runner-images/issues/12677
windows / clang-build
The windows-latest label will migrate from Windows Server 2022 to Windows Server 2025 beginning September 2, 2025. For more information see https://github.com/actions/runner-images/issues/12677
windows / clang-test
The windows-latest label will migrate from Windows Server 2022 to Windows Server 2025 beginning September 2, 2025. For more information see https://github.com/actions/runner-images/issues/12677
windows / msvc-test
The windows-latest label will migrate from Windows Server 2022 to Windows Server 2025 beginning September 2, 2025. For more information see https://github.com/actions/runner-images/issues/12677
windows / clang-test-extended
The windows-latest label will migrate from Windows Server 2022 to Windows Server 2025 beginning September 2, 2025. For more information see https://github.com/actions/runner-images/issues/12677
windows / msvc-test-extended
The windows-latest label will migrate from Windows Server 2022 to Windows Server 2025 beginning September 2, 2025. For more information see https://github.com/actions/runner-images/issues/12677

Artifacts

Produced during runtime
Name Size Digest
cov-report Expired
50.9 KB
sha256:d1a02f80932880e3accff1d24ead0d3924c7f3f3a422f21c904064343a944caf
doxygen-documentation-xml Expired
81.1 KB
sha256:d841f4f6c20e80b4ff7133d11291fbf567c7bb497374f25379d7a627294003e7
macos-clang-debug-install Expired
3.95 MB
sha256:80e3f10ee015ccaccf7a62fceebd1cdabc0cb267c5bee7be50d3c0007cc1677f
macos-clang-install Expired
1.6 MB
sha256:9fb0b1d7bc3686324ec55f28e9a8dcaa18f6589bd9df7365bfc1a31567a996ba
perf-stat Expired
12 KB
sha256:cdddd2400e695ed82ff6423aa7e37476a73bef398514f5cbe223ab525d9a8a88
scoreboard Expired
1.17 KB
sha256:5f52dde2c79cc59799c49acd53aee1d4d302d82f1d7c7a0e5de994840b19c2fc
sphinx-documentation Expired
14.9 MB
sha256:eb050a3f6fa71367aa5ccdcee1d77682a233f02588f6da63ae84a4a8ad572a29
ubuntu-clang-install-ubuntu-24.04 Expired
2.34 MB
sha256:ab0724674e0c1f8d0af53ebb90e3ee58ada998408de701f12ac659a519efb79f
ubuntu-clang-install-ubuntu-24.04-arm Expired
2.26 MB
sha256:7621039cab7201b0287d701db38fbc094ecebc9fa1858e8a7e83bf31da0b1da8
ubuntu-clang-sanitizer-install-ubuntu-24.04 Expired
14.1 MB
sha256:89432238b8a6a5d5164a34d22564e39c95528b9fd9809e0c65e4d4d5eef95c21
ubuntu-gcc-debug-install-ubuntu-24.04 Expired
14.2 MB
sha256:3d3849db9fd7e68dfa63d59cf0219966d1c71f7e42f6e743bf5aab05cbef3305
ubuntu-gcc-debug-install-ubuntu-24.04-arm Expired
14 MB
sha256:484d3b1c88c51fc25772d7c0bf5f1d22002800018f86c21ccc649b0ca343c8d2
ubuntu-gcc-install-ubuntu-24.04 Expired
3.1 MB
sha256:e7f8d114941141dfca6fc79227fa2c4e541096172bb07593cab2abea8f0d5ad9
ubuntu-gcc-install-ubuntu-24.04-arm Expired
2.89 MB
sha256:be7ffb85823f37d6a53ca35987c78ed0d47b1b60d94ad3de5de383fbb12c8ace
windows-clang-install Expired
1.86 MB
sha256:fb091faf0e44cab2b0b410b2e8cc099d3f3e324365634433010558be8291c581
windows-msvc-debug-install Expired
6.38 MB
sha256:6be6e993c975a55dade7972e79e23a1ba59423a3ecf5c4b2f4a1f83ca53389eb
windows-msvc-install Expired
1.86 MB
sha256:856bb4278bfa6cdc912cda44dbe8c3725d0e431d29299b3779e41f65f8a98ed7